A nose of blackcurrant, licorice and marked spicy aromas. On the palate, the wine is plump, full-bodied, extremely appealing with fruity substance and still marked young tannins, which will mellow in time.
"The dark ruby/purple-colored Pichon Longueville Baron reveals aromas of charcoal, black currants, and sweet toasty oak. This low acid, medium-bodied, charming, lush 1999 possesses good stuffing, ripe tannin, and a moderately long finish. "
89 Points
The Wine Advocate
